Double Glazing Window Repairs

If you notice condensation on the window panes, it is time to repair double glazing. This is usually a less expensive option than replacing the entire unit.

doorpanels-300x200.jpgHowever it is recommended to seek help from a professional as it's a difficult and risky task. It requires specialised tools as well as knowledge of window mechanisms and joinery.

Replacement of the Glass

The price of replacing double-glazed windows is contingent on the size, brand, and frame material of the window replacement. A glazier can provide you with an estimate of the cost of replacing glass. They will also be able to advise you on the best kind of glass to fit your needs and your home, as different kinds of glass provide different energy savings.

The most frequent issue with double-glazed windows is condensation and mist. This can be caused by leaks in the seal or issue with the frame. Contact the company from which you bought windows if you're experiencing issues. The majority of companies provide a warranty and be able to offer a solution for this problem.

Some of these companies will be able to carry out a small repair for you that involves drilling a hole in the glass and then spraying it with a specific substance that absorbs moisture. This is a temporary solution and will require to be repeated in the future. If the issue continues to persist, it is better to consult an expert.

If you've got a damaged window that requires immediate attention then a glazier can offer a 24/7 emergency service and is typically able to come out at the weekend. They can replace the broken glass quickly and efficiently, and will ensure that the new window is properly sealed to provide the correct amount of insulation. They can also provide you with a an estimate to replace the entire window. This is usually more expensive, however it could be the best solution if the windows have other issues.

A professional will also be able to assist you with any other issues that you might have regarding your double glazing for instance, having trouble opening and closing the window or door. They can check for any issues with the hinges, locking mechanism and handles. They can also install trickle vents on your doors and windows to allow fresh air to circulate into your home without allowing cold air to escape. This can help to reduce humidity and condensation in the room and will improve the comfort of your home.

Replacement of the Frame

Over time, the frames of your double-glazed windows will begin to deteriorate. It can make them difficult to open or close, and allow air in draughts. Contact your provider for advice. They'll be able to repair the worn parts, Window Repair making sure that your window functions properly again.

Another issue that is common to double-glazed windows is that they can mist up. This happens when the seal between panes is damaged and the insulating gases inside are not being retained. This can be fixed by drilling a small hole in the window and injecting desiccant. This will absorb moisture and a plug will then be inserted into the hole to prevent it from happening again.

If you have a window that is not closing or opening properly, this could be the result of a damaged hinge or handle, or defective locks. This can be fixed easily by an UPVC specialist who can replace the handles, hinges or locks, and restore your double glazing to full functionality.

It is cheaper to repair your windows than replace them. It's also green because less materials are utilized. If you are worried about the cost of repairing your double-glazed windows contact a number of companies and request a quote. This will help you select the best company for the job, and will ensure that your windows are fixed quickly and effectively.

A reputable company will offer a warranty on their work. They will be able to provide you with details of the warranty that came with your double glazed windows. This is typically an assurance of 10 or 20 years, but some companies offer lifetime guarantees on their products. Getting your double glazing fixed as soon as you notice any issues will allow you to avoid costly repairs in the future, and also save money on your energy costs.

Replacement of the Seals

Sometimes, the seals that join the double-glazing panes could be damaged. This is often the reason for mist between the windows or condensation. If it is not treated, it could lead to moisture in your home that can cause damage to the wooden frames, cause drafts and even make it difficult to open and close your window or doors. If you find that your double-glazed windows are experiencing any of these issues, it is recommended to consult a window expert or glazier to fix the problem.

The specialist will remove the glass from the frame, and then replace it with a new gas that stops air from getting through the gap. Then, they'll apply sealant to ensure this does not happen again.

This is only an interim fix however it will prevent any moisture from getting trapped within your double glazing and ensure that it's functional. This won't work for windows that are filled with Argon gas.

If you have a misted window that doesn't cause leaks, some companies offer the option of drilling tiny holes in your double-glazed window to eliminate the moisture inside. This is a temporary fix that must be repeated in six months.

Some people also use this method to reseal their windows if the desiccant contained in them has lost its effectiveness. The process involves drilling tiny holes in the glass and then adding the new desiccant in order to reseal your windows.

UPVC handles and UPVC hinges are designed to last a long time. However, they can break or wear out over time. Replacement of the Hardware

The hinges, locking mechanisms, and handles of double-glazed windows may also be damaged periodically. When this happens, it could be difficult to open or close the window, and it can be noisy. In most instances, the damage to the hinge or handle can be repaired. If the lock is completely damaged, it should be replaced.

Another common issue is when the windows or doors begin to shrink or drop a little. Extreme temperatures can cause the frame to expand and shrink. In this instance, wiping frames with cold water can help them shrink slightly. The hinges or mechanism may need to be oiled.

It is always a smart idea to get in touch with the company that installed your double glazing in case you encounter any issues. They will be able to provide you with advice on the best method of action. In some cases, the problem is easily fixed by re-sealing the seals. In other instances, the whole glass unit will need to be replaced.

In some instances, the double-glazed windows can begin to fog or develop condensation between the panes of glass. This is an indication of a damaged seal and the need to replace it. In the majority of cases replacing the glass will allow you to keep your existing window frames. This is a more affordable option than having them replaced.

Some companies offer to drill double glazing that has accumulated condensation to remove the moisture. However, this is usually only a temporary solution and the condensation will return. In the majority of instances, the best option is to replace double-glazed windows. In this case you can use this as an opportunity to upgrade your window to A-rated energy efficient glass. This will increase the insulation of your home as well as reduce your heating expenses. If the windows have been installed by a professional this will be included in the price of the work. If you decide to do the job yourself, you could end up facing significant costs for new frames as well as new double glazing glass.
